进入目录
/home/ 存放用户目录
cd 进入目录
cd / 进入根目录
cd或cd ~进入用户目录
cd . 进入当前目录
cd ..返回上级目录
cd../.. 返回上两级目录
cd../a/ 进入上级目录下a目录
cd – 返回1上一次的目录 注意区分上一次与上一级
pwd 查看当前位置
相对路径和绝对路径
绝对路径 查找起点为根路径,从根路径一直到目标位置
案例;当前位置在/home/admin/BBB/b
使用绝对路径查看a.txt位置 ll /home/admin/BBB/a/aa/a.txt
使用相对路径看a.txt位置 ll ../a/aa/a.txt
创建目录文件
mkdir 目录名 在当前位置创建目录
mkdir 路径 目录名 在指定目录下创建目录
mkdir -p 目录1/目录2 在当前位置创建目录1,且在目录1中创建目录2
mkdir 目录1 目录2 在当前位置同时创建目录1和目录2
查找目录
find 路径 -name 文件名 查找指定目录下的文件,显示的是文件的绝对路径
find -name 文件名 查找当前目录下的文件,显示的是相对路径
查看目录内容
ll/ls 查看目录中的内容 不显示隐藏目录和隐藏文件
ll/ls -la 显示目录中所用内容 包含隐藏文件和目录
ll *.txt 查看.txt文件
ll a 显示目录中所有包含a的文件
rm-rf* 删除当前目录下的所有文件/目录
rm-rf 文件名 删除指定文件/目录
rm-rf a
ll a/ 操作指定目录
/ 目录分隔符
>:文件名 创建新文件/清空当前目录 touch a.txt 创建文件
保存退出
wq 保存并推出 先退出编辑室状态按esc
q! 退出不保存 先退出编辑室状态按esc
编辑文件
vi 文件名:编辑文件
vim 文件名:编辑文件
tal -f 文件名
查看文件
cat 文件名 查看文件
cat 文件名 |grep 关键字/tail-100f文件名 查看文件内容,且只显示包含关键值得行
tail -100f 查看倒数100行的
查看ip地址
ifconfig 看ip
ping +ip地址 查是否能连接其他设备
结束命令
ctrl+c 结束命令
清空命令
clear 清空命令
日期
cal 日期
date 日期
重启命令
reboot 重启命令
df -h 查看磁盘空间
切换账户
su 切换root账号密码 123456
su 用户名 切换到指定用户
useradd 用户名 创建普通用户(root用户操作)
passwd 用户名 为指定用户设置密码(root用户操作)
复制移动文件
cp 文件名1文件名2 将文件1复制到当前目录下,且复制后的文件名为文件名2
cp a.txt /home/admin/BBB/a/a.txt 将a.txt移动到/home/admin/BBB/a/,且文件名为a.txt
(cp 源文件不删除,mv源文件不付出在)
mv a.txt /home/admin/BBB/a/a.txt 将a.txt移动到/homg/admin/BBB/a/,文件名为a.txt
复制粘贴
ctrl+insert 复制
alt+insert 粘贴
注意
Xshell上传文件/下载文件
需要打开Xftp,使用双击或者拖拽进行
使用Xftp上传文件时,需要注意链接的用户,而不是Xshell当切换的用户
使用Xshell切换用户后,使用Xftp时,使用的还是创建这个连接的用户
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
文章由极客之音整理,本文链接:https://www.bmabk.com/index.php/post/97229.html